Study of a Draped Figure

Study of a Draped Figure by Giovanni Battista Tiepolo

Medium

red chalk on laid paper

Dimensions

sheet: 24.2 × 16.3 cm (9 1/2 × 6 7/16 in.) mount: 28.3 × 20.6 cm (11 1/8 × 8 1/8 in.)

Classification

Drawing

Department

CG-E

Museum

National Gallery of Art, Washington, D.C.

Credit

Purchased as the Gift of Andrea Woodner

Accession Number

2018.76.1

About the Artist

Giovanni Battista Tiepolo · 16961770

Giovanni Battista Tiepolo (1696-1770) stands as the greatest decorative painter of eighteenth-century Europe, a Venetian master whose luminous frescoes and dynamic compositions defined the Rococo era's aesthetic zenith.
